Transaction 5411478d3be40fd7f67434d5dbaec49668c34909add29700e913e36fb4ea1f59

block
d472e753564bd8ff3c3dc45d653cb2ef0e83ba651c1c4f47a0c581956296ccc6

1 Input

25 Outputs